Ruth R. Faden, PhD, is the recipient of the 2025 Bernard Lo, MD Award in Bioethics. The award recognizes Prof. Faden for excellence in bioethics mentorship and conveys a cash prize of $25,000.
Prof. Ruth R. Faden Receives the Bernard Lo, MD Award in Bioethics for Excellence in Bioethics Mentorship

“Prof. Faden’s mentorship is exceptional for its breadth and reach across backgrounds and disciplines,” said Michelle Groman, JD, President & CEO of The Greenwall Foundation. “She has dedicated her career to lifting up the next generation of bioethics professionals, who continue to pay it forward as outstanding mentors themselves. It’s not surprising; they have certainly learned from one of the best.”
Prof. Faden has had a profound impact on the bioethics field. A professor of biomedical ethics, she founded the Berman Institute of Bioethics at Johns Hopkins University more than 25 years ago, creating a home for countless students, trainees, and scholars. Her accomplishments are many, but as one of her mentees attested, her role as mentor may rank supreme.
“I was thrilled, and a bit overcome,” Prof. Faden said on receiving the award. “Being a mentor continues to be the most precious, and rewarding, part of my career. Playing a role, however small, in a talented person’s succeeding in bioethics is a gift, for me.”
Prof. Faden has nurtured an entire ecosystem of bioethics professionals and guided them into a wide range of careers in the field. She has empowered her mentees to make meaningful contributions to bioethics and continue her legacy of thoughtful and generous mentorship.
The Greenwall Foundation established the Lo Award to honor Dr. Lo’s service to The Greenwall Foundation as its President & CEO from 2012 to 2020 and founding Director of the Foundation’s flagship Faculty Scholars Program. The Lo Award is given annually and recognizes a different area of accomplishment in bioethics each year.
